We are pleased to announce the launch of Cinema: Journal of Philosophy and the Moving Image. Its inaugural issue is now available for free download on http://www.fcsh.unl.pt/revistas/cjpmi.


Cinema: Journal of Philosophy and the Moving Image is a new international peer-reviewed publication devoted to the philosophical inquiry into cinema. It gathers scholars and contributions from different philosophical traditions and it is published online by the Philosophy of Language Institute, Faculty of Social and Human Sciences, New University of Lisbon.
